Fertility & birth rates in Luxembourg and Panama

Updated on by Georank team

Luxembourg has an annual birth rate of 9.5 births per 1,000 people, compared to 16 for Panama. The average number of children a woman is expected to have during her lifetime — the fertility rate, is 1.25 in Luxembourg and 2.12 in Panama — 69.5% difference.

1960 vs 2023, the fertility rate has decreased by 45.4% in Luxembourg and by 63.6% in Panama — in 1960, it was 2.29 and 5.83, respectively.

  • Luxembourg is ranked 152/196 by birth rate compared to 95/196 for Panama.
  • The mean age at childbearing (for all the births, not just the first) is 32.3 in Luxembourg — it's 27.5 in Panama.
  • Annual births per 1,000 women ages 15-19 (adolescent birth rate or teenage mother rate) is 4.02 in Luxembourg vs 57.3 in Panama.
  • In Luxembourg, 23.9% of the population is composed of women of reproductive age (15-49), compared to 25.2% in Panama.

According to the latest available data on birth rates, the fertility rate in Luxembourg was 1.25 children per woman in 2023, compared to 2.12 in Panama in 2023. The replacement level is considered to be 2.1 children per woman.

The chart above illustrates the comparison of the absolute yearly changes in population resulting from births and deaths.

Excluding migration, the natural population change due to births and deaths from 2022 to 2023 was +0.29% in Luxembourg and +1.13% in Panama.

For the past 10 years, the annual natural population change has been +0.33% in Luxembourg and +1.31% in Panama.

The maternal mortality rate, which is the probability of dying during childbirth or within 42 days of pregnancy termination, is 11 deaths per 100,000 live births in Luxembourg, compared to 37 deaths in Panama.
